Description
The Coach Houses at Dumfries House are a detached building dating from the 18th century. The facade features a pediment and has a slight projection in the center. On the ground floor, there are round-headed coach house doors, while the attic has rectangular windows. Another detached building at the rear forms an L-shaped range that encloses a courtyard.
